Deer Park Storm Roof Leak Drivers
Water damage in Deer Park tends to cluster in predictable windows because of the local climate. Deer Park experiences frequent thunderstorms and heavy rainfall, especially during the spring and summer months, which can lead to sudden roof leaks. The region's mountainous terrain can cause rapid runoff, increasing the risk of water infiltration during intense weather events. A close second is Cold snaps in the winter can cause ice dams to form along the eaves, leading to water backup and potential roof leaks. Sudden temperature changes can also stress roofing materials, making them more susceptible to damage..
